    Cloud Imperium Games is looking for a talented IT Network Engineer to join our Austin, Studio team!

    The IT Network Engineer at Cloud Imperium Games is responsible for the daily performance, maintenance, and availability of the organization's network infrastructure.

    The ideal candidate for this role will have 5 years of experience in the IT Networking sector. The job demands a sound understanding of wired and wireless networking, general IT functions, and the security operations related to data networks.

    Tasks are subject to evolve as this team grows and as business demands change.

    R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Deploy, and maintain a robust LAN and WAN infrastructure
    • Configure and install software, servers, routers and other network devices
    • Monitor network performance and integrity
    • Respond to and address network alerts
    • Mentor team members on technical issues
    • Maintain complete technical documentation
    • and other such duties and responsibilities assigned by Cloud Imperium reasonably consistent with the employee's skills and experience

    REQUIREMENTS:

    • At least 5 years of experience as an IT Network Engineer or equivalent
    • Solid background in network administration and architecture, including datacenter infrastructures
    • Experience analyzing network traffic for optimization and security-related events
    • In-depth understanding of communication and routing protocols (TCP/IP, BGP, OSPF, MPLS)
    • Knowledge of Python scripting language for automation
    • Proficiency with Cisco IOS network operating system
    • International travel may be required as a part of this role

    COMPETENCIES:

    • Detailed knowledge of firewall concepts, computer/network security, VPNs, proxy, and load balancing
    • Windows OS, Linux OS, and VMware virtualization
    • Cisco and Meraki network equipment
    • Amazon Web Services, Microsoft Azure, and Office 365

    PLUSES:

    • Professional certification (CCNP, VMware or equivalent)
    • Experience in game publishing
    • Passion for sci-fi games and space simulations
    • Proficiency with Jira & Confluence
